Word 2007. I have a single page A4 portrait document constructed as
follows: at the top, text that goes from one side of the page to the
other. I then have a section break, with a table consisting of three
columns and one row.
What I need to be able to do is to type or paste text and/or small
graphics etc into each column, BUT I do NOT want the text to either wrap
into the next column, OR, create an extension to the column on the next
page. In other words, I want what is put into each column to use the
available space, and not to create new space - a fixed column size. The
document can ONLY be one page long. I have tried all the options I can see
in Table Properties, but can't seem to fix this. is it possible even?


I think I may have fixed it - I created a new document and set the height of
the row in the table to be an exact measurement in Table Properties....we
shall see.... :-)
